Beta 3.11
Pre-release
Pre-release
Changes:
- 37fdebd Merge branch 'master' of https://github.com/wildernesslabs/meadow.core
- 6161964 Bump version to 0.13.0
- 71ba15b Merge pull request #70 from WildernessLabs/develop
- 3d2451e Multi interrupts (#71)
- 8cc5257 Update to ITextDisplay interface
- 5a4f39b Add/update classes to support IObservable for accelerometers
- fcd4cfe Merge remote-tracking branch 'origin/bugfix/i2c' into develop
- c8b1489 added DS_Store garbage
- a1928b0 Remove SetBrightness from IDisplayMenu
- 18b9a71 atmospheric condition elements nullable
See More
- 61a27e1 More I2C Span work
- 8eb1454 Merge pull request #69 from WildernessLabs/develop
- 2925694 Update Meadow.Core for B3.10 [ #67, #79 ]
- d093bf0 Bump for B3.10 release
- d0b778f removed debug message
- 5c16804 I2c writeread (#67) [ #79 ]
- d2e5090 Update azure-pipelines.yml for Azure Pipelines
- da8a6a4 Merge pull request #66 from WildernessLabs/release3.9
- e6e1d90 bump for 0.3.9 release
- ff5d869 Add clock test app
- 1e549fd Update azure-pipelines.yml for Azure Pipelines
- 2439107 Update azure-pipelines.yml for Azure Pipelines
- 82a4cc7 Update azure-pipelines.yml for Azure Pipelines
- 33da778 Re-apply the PWM hack/workaround (#64)
- 2a67da5 PWM bugfix (#79) (#63)
- 572265e Feature/serial (#62)
- 883ad0c Update azure-pipelines.yml for Azure Pipelines
- 5eedb59 Update azure-pipelines.yml for Azure Pipelines
- d14452c Merge pull request #60 from WildernessLabs/feature/unhandled-exceptions
- 35b9561 Console output on unhandled exceptions
- ab26eb7 Bump version to 0.11.2 for b3.8
- 5d7442e Merge pull request #59 from WildernessLabs/bugfix/i2c-refactor
- 0ec9412 add ability to set SPI bits per word
- 7a0b9ae Merge pull request #57 from WildernessLabs/bugfix/spi
- 2bb8506 Bump Meadow.Core version for publishing to 0.11.1
- 2716f2a Merge pull request #58 from WildernessLabs/dev_joystick
- a55877a Adding safety to I2C bus speed. Added Span support
- a5f579a Fix OldValue field
- d6d71e6 debug messaging
- 1956e00 Refactor and cleanup
- 940cacb Rename JoystickConditions to JoystickPosition
- dac2d27 SPI error messaging
- 4b63ddb Merge pull request #56 from WildernessLabs/bugfix/spi
- b7c3461 Merge remote-tracking branch 'origin/dev_joystick' into bugfix/spi
- d5509e9 Fixed default value regression
- f551574 Add IObserable pattern to Joystick
- 36c48b9 Merge pull request #55 from WildernessLabs/bugfix/spi
- 96ccd63 More I2C messages
- 92a7c20 improved I2C error messages
- 85c5cda SPI freq update
- 2e9ed68 Merge remote-tracking branch 'origin/master' into bugfix/spi
- f8118c8 Merge pull request #53 from WildernessLabs/bugfix/pwm
- 989305a Merge pull request #54 from WildernessLabs/bugfix/i2c_freq
- af14174 I2C comment improvements. Functional test of changing clock speed at runtime.
- d7e47f8 added clarification comments
- 72ab6b4 added doc comments
- b76427c more doc comments
- e0d5fb7 Code clean-up. Adding doc comments
- 5d5f1a9 Fixing the F7 device for I2C
- 9ceb1c8 Merge remote-tracking branch 'origin/master' into bugfix/pwm
- 598f83f Deal with workaround method accessibility
- 0451906 Deal with workaround method accessibility
- a4d2eb9 Merge pull request #52 from WildernessLabs/revert-50-bugfix/pwm
- eaa1f79 Revert "Pwm hack/workaround"
- 7dfe9c7 Merge pull request #51 from WildernessLabs/b3.7
- 39999f5 bump version to 0.11.0 and change assembly reference
- bd24260 Merge pull request #50 from WildernessLabs/bugfix/pwm
- 35bd901 Pwm hack/workaround
- f3bd1c4 Merge pull request #49 from WildernessLabs/bugfix/i2c_freq
- fea43a6 Frequency fix. Added docs.
- d62d4f6 Merge pull request #48 from WildernessLabs/bugfix/spi
- 0bb6c56 Allow changing of a single config property
- 6c9ad9c Merge pull request #47 from WildernessLabs/bugfix/spi
- b0ba41f Make SPI configuration publicly settable outside a ctor
- edd5ab7 moved interfaces to the proper folder
- 805a1b9 Merge pull request #46 from WildernessLabs/bugfix/spi
- 30cf747 spi peripheral fix
- 542b3b2 Merge pull request #45 from WildernessLabs/bugfix/i2c_freq
- 9713f9d Merge pull request #44 from WildernessLabs/bugfix/pwm
- 3547ac8 Made I2C freq publicly settable
- df0b27f Hide DirectRegisterAccess string message
- 77436b0 updated profiler app
- 7b90a9a interrupt test app
- 0cde35e PWM frequency checks
- 498e645 Merge pull request #43 from WildernessLabs/bugfix/adc
- 323f692 bugfix for Chris' stupidity....
- 8ccb177 ADC cleaning
- 95a5f48 Enable speed settings for I2C + minor cleanup - v0.10.2
- 3a42e72 Remove uneeded Console.Writelines
- 0b9a9d0 Update nuget version to 0.10.0
- 395b3c8 Merge pull request #42 from WildernessLabs/feature/io-perf
- 1dc8da8 Improved IO performance
- ade7d89 quiet debug messages
- 8fdf288 Merge pull request #41 from WildernessLabs/bugfix/house-cleaning
- 593c007 added some class docs
- ac5e929 House cleaning of console writes, error handling, etc.
- be4a3f6 Merge pull request #40 from WildernessLabs/bugfix/digital-input
- c160527 working on a resistor bug
- 4bcf090 bug fix for input state in event
- de8b076 Added clamp to onboard LED pwm to 0.85
- 3cea401 Merge pull request #39 from WildernessLabs/BugFix/RgbLed_CommonType
- 7d1f9b3 merging changes, and lots of cleanup.
- 21c6f7d Merge branch 'master' into BugFix/RgbLed_CommonType
- 3965e21 adding commonType for cathode/anode
- be457b9 moving to C# 8
- d639444 Merge pull request #37 from WildernessLabs/bugfix/pwm
- 61cdab2 Merge branch 'master' into bugfix/pwm
- 5f6f83f Merge pull request #36 from WildernessLabs/bugfix/spi
- 6a82b07 Merge pull request #38 from WildernessLabs/spelling_fix_for_DigitalChannelIInfoBase
- bc57d05 Fixed some spelling stuff
- fc08f50 PWM clean-up
- 5fe5e61 PWM issue 26 (channel support check)
- 893c779 SpiPeripheral clean-up
- f9bbc64 Added TODO
- eb3ff47 [Update] Meadow.Core 0.9.0
- 3f40553 Added smoe docs on how to use.
- 54e33fb Renaming some serial port members for clarity.
- 055aa6f Remove legacy unused enums
- 6a76314 Reordered Serial Port ctor parameters to follow the 8N1 convention
- e8c9877 copied docs to interface.
- 86c275e style
- 982b487 Rename discard to clear and style cleanup.
- 80818bf cleanup
- d4be6cd Merge pull request #35 from WildernessLabs/feature/serial
- 3ed9b31 Merge remote-tracking branch 'origin/master' into feature/serial
- d1d1510 Improved serial port work
- 300a203 rework of the serial API
- e46279b Not sure what happened, honestly, an extra serialport showed up.
- 1df8285 updating to new project format.
- 63f6a2a Merge pull request #34 from WildernessLabs/feature/serial
- 667b402 Merge pull request #33 from WildernessLabs/AddMissingSPIConstructorDefinition
- 52b4571 Merge remote-tracking branch 'origin/master' into feature/serial
- 6284574 extracted ISerialPort interface
- acde97d Added missing constructor to IIODevice.
- 8249667 fixing version
- 570cfce Merge pull request #32 from WildernessLabs/feature/serial
- 705cb47 serial settings bug fix
- e527aa3 Merge remote-tracking branch 'origin/master' into feature/serial
- 0990e39 Merge pull request #31 from WildernessLabs/feature/spi
- 3095223 bugfix is SpiPeripheral ReadRegisters
- 021c3ca More helper method on SerialPort
- bd9287b added DiscardInBuffer
- 52bf015 serial stuff
- 57357a1 quiet I2C debug output
- 4f66e52 Merge pull request #30 from WildernessLabs/feature/serial
- 247ca31 Merge branch 'feature/adc_cleanup' into feature/serial
- b1b2e0a Interface cleanup
- 6d2ea86 More serial port work
- 205e8b2 Serial is now working
- e638e6f Merge branch 'feature/serial' into feature/serial-debug
- cbe1fd9 Bug identified
- 070fce7 Merge commit '365814ff7170b11e5151a724db369e575d38d313' into feature/serial-debug
- 1cf266f more test app work
- 7491ee7 Merge commit 'e7606ffde9e1dfb34a97d94c47e867c84caa8db6' into feature/serial-debug
- 65038fe updated test app
- c14b7bd Merge commit '2c8a05a6740d66d1df1cde6fc764e89f1ed61140' into feature/serial-debug
- 245a887 hunting a serial killer
- ba89cdf Merge commit 'f704468cc6923b493087fd445186843cb46da53c' into feature/serial-debug
- 4a702ce Changing some names and cleaing things up.
- 6cda183 Update IMoistureSensor method declaration
- 8b5cbc5 forget to clean this up before, when i was testing.
- d2e3daa Simplified naming
- 7c8d84e renamed parameter to be consistent.
- 914f6a0 renamed a parameter and added docs.
- b1cdad0 removed methods that are specific to analog sensors.
- ce65378 renamed methods to support composite sensors (sensors that might have multiple inputs)
- e33b562 Fixed StartUpdating to return immediately.
- 11f36e7 getting rid of extraneous console writeline debug message
- a8999c6 set a reasonable default readIntervalDuration.
- e86df76 addings and renaming parameters to make things clearer.
- 9533921 renaming sampleSleepDuration, fixing a wrong thing, updating durations to sensible stuffs, and adding docs. worst commit message ever, i know.
- 61ae601 interface cleanup
- 8a799e4 better interface and more docs
- 38feca5 Cleanup up changed event naming
- 4cffba6 WIP on multi observer state muh cheen.
- bfd7d7e ISensor and other cleanups.
- 9ec93a8 docs
- 7784883 small cleanup
- 9ef7d13 added sensible constructor.
- ccfeadc removed duplicate methods
- f4082da saving previous voltage now.
- b0ab155 Merge remote-tracking branch 'origin/master' into feature/serial
- 23e499b bump version
- e7aaa38 added Exchange overload
- 63eb9b1 TX/RX fix for SPI ExchangeData method - bump to 0.8.7
- 4a7bded bump version to 0.8.6
- d6aca4e Remove unsafe property groups from csproj
- af1eea3 Merge pull request #29 from WildernessLabs/feature/spi
- 57cffeb UPD improved messages
- 562524a more serial work
- b092350 more serial port work
- 365814f serial loopback working
- 3a7bfc5 Merge branch 'feature/spi' into feature/serial
- f9b335e SPI clean-up
- 4576cb5 added additional Exchange method
- 5a137de Gah, bug fix
- 6263acf test Spi implementation
- 1fc6689 fixed edge-case SPI bug
- a1d707c Merge remote-tracking branch 'origin/master' into feature/serial
- e7606ff spelling fix
- 3a89f80 working on serial read
- c5779c2 renamed and refactored some SPI configs a little bit.
- 2c8a05a Serial port work
- 565f481 nuttx folder enumeration
- 4f58238 Merge remote-tracking branch 'origin/master' into feature/serial
- 3abb840 [Update] Meadow.Core Version 0.8.5
- 567d535 Merge pull request #28 from WildernessLabs/feature/spi
- f6f2608 Update SpiBus mode logic
- f206cea Added support for SPI mode
- 86b128a SPI refactor to use clock config, clean-up, adding comments
- b78f690 Added SPI code comments
- f704468 Serial work
- 144ecef Merge pull request #27 from WildernessLabs/feature/spi
- 7acdf59 Update F7Micro default speed settings to 375kHz
- 06918e0 Merge pull request #26 from WildernessLabs/feature/spi
- 3595c48 Remove missing serial project from sln
- b00e994 Merge remote-tracking branch 'origin/feature/spi' into feature/serial
- 9f7f781 Merge remote-tracking branch 'origin/master' into feature/serial
- 8ebf086 Minor fix for SPI speed calculation logic
- 97aa6d2 added SPI bus frequency bits
- 24eab81 Connect PwmPort Inverted property to hardware layer
- c6807e9 [Update] Meadow.Core 0.8.4 - Comment Output PWM values
- 5279ed4 Turn off debugging ADC prints.
- 5ec978a remove extra versions
- b91bc10 add WildernessLabs.Meadow.Assemblies as dep
- 6d5d290 removed debug.
- 0d42877 Upgraded project.
- f3506af [Update] Meadow.Core Version 0.8.2
- 7c9e55d Fix build warnings.
- 7329231 Fix build issue with Mono msbuild.
- c3997c2 Fix stopping of PWM channels to pass the channel back to NuttX.
- 4af71ff working on SPI2 support
- dddcfda starting serial work
- 863196d Merge remote-tracking branch 'origin/feature/spiConstructorFix' into feature/spi
- 03ea246 Merge branch 'master' into feature/spi
- 897137b Fixed constructor using names pins.
- 9c6e1bf Remove conole writeline calls in SpiBus and bump to v 0.8.1
- 10d4797 [Update] Meadow.Core Version 0.8.0
- 9055444 Merge pull request #23 from WildernessLabs/feature/adc-direct
- c160b2c minor cleanup
- 9846f2d Merge pull request #22 from WildernessLabs/feature/adc-direct
- bb0b2b8 Fixed array bounds bug.
- eb76d6c updated project to new and fixing up analog observer stuff.
- c375e41 fixup of analog stuff to modern API.
- 1169663 updated project to new style.
- db038d4 added (untested) SPI speed logic
- 23209dc added some ADC constants
- 8151c42 set sampling for ADC PA4 and PA5
- 90b9e72 ADCs A0-A3 confirmed working individually
This list of changes was auto generated.